Is he leaving or staying?

The continuity of Ricardo Gareca in the national team has not ceased to be news in the sports field, despite the fact that the 'Tigre' is taking some time off with his family in Argentina. But from there, other voices can also be heard, like that of Reinaldo Merlo.

Interviewed by the media Depor, 'Mostaza', remembered for his feat of leading Racing Club to win its first local title after 35 years of drought (Torneo Apertura 2001), did not hesitate to give his impressions about the work of 'El Flaco' in Peru and even dared to give him some advice.

Merlo, master of the philosophy of "step by step" evoked by Gareca for his campaign with the national team, saw his results very positively. "(Gareca) didn't have that dose of luck that you need in a World Cup, but he played a very good football. With the ball on the ground, faithful to his philosophy."

Although he couldn't advance from the group stage, the renowned midfielder of River Plate considered that the national team coach "had a great World Cup. Not everything is measured in terms of results. The work is something deeper. Now, what he needs is to sustain this good moment," he added.

But that's not all. 'Mostaza' went further by stating that the destiny of 'El Tigre' is here. "I hope he stays. He should do it because he has the material to exploit. He has done things very well. He gave Peru the push it needed."

"It's purely his decision. But I, from the bottom of my heart, wish he stays in Peru," he added. In the experienced coach's vision, the national team "has a bunch of very good and supportive players in every line."

"Ricardo has built a compact team. That is precisely the great merit of 'El Flaco'. As I told you, Peru should have qualified for the round of 16 (...) Peru has returned to playing as it did in the 70s, when it had footballers with very good technique... talented ones."

This return to the roots of the team is key for what is to come, he asserted. "(Peru) always had that kind of individualities. Seriously, I see them very well to face Qatar 2022."
